A eukaryotic cell spreads over a substrate in distinct stages, with the earliest events characterized by passive adhesion and cell deformation. Recent work suggests a common physical mechanism can explain the early stages of cell spreading for a wide range of cell types and substrates. cell_spreading.txt Last modified: 2024/06/07 02:55by 127.0.0.1
